Work You'll Do
As Integration Engineer II you will have hands-on integration development skills to develop solutions streamlining business processes working with internal teams, near-shore, off-shore technologists and vendor relationships. You will be part of API management strategies to enable seamless communication between applications. You will work across geographies with accountability for the success, effectiveness and delivery of multiple work streams, managing a large, dispersed technology team.
Key Responsibilities
- Design end-to-end system architecture spanning frontend, backend, integration layers, and cloud infrastructure, translating requirements into scalable Azure-based solutions
- Define technical standards, Integration design patterns, and best practices to guide the development team
- Create and maintain architecture diagrams, technical specifications, and design documents, including data mapping and configuration details
- Build backend services and APIs using Python (e.g., FastAPI, Django, Flask), Javascript, Azure, Typescript or using enterprise integration tools like MuleSoft , Apigee, Kong, Workato, BizTalk.
- Design, build, and integrate RESTful APIs - connecting third-party and internal systems for reliable, consistent data exchange
- Implement API security (OAuth2, JWT, API keys), versioning, rate limiting, and robust error handling
- Manage the full software development lifecycle (SDLC), including developing, testing, and deploying integration processes across Test, UAT, and Production environments
- Monitor integration performance, proactively troubleshoot issues, and provide expert-level post-deployment support
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to optimize data flows and ensure adherence to integration best practices
- Take ownership of assigned projects, manage stakeholder expectations, and mentor junior team members toward successful delivery
